
CAS 1024222-54-5
:2-{1-[3,5-bis(trifluoromethyl)anilino]ethylidene}-1H-indene-1,3(2H)-dione
Description:
The chemical substance known as 2-{1-[3,5-bis(trifluoromethyl)anilino]ethylidene}-1H-indene-1,3(2H)-dione, with the CAS number 1024222-54-5, is a synthetic organic compound characterized by its complex molecular structure. It features an indene-1,3-dione core, which is a diketone known for its reactivity and ability to participate in various chemical reactions, including Michael additions and condensation reactions. The presence of the 3,5-bis(trifluoromethyl)aniline moiety introduces significant electron-withdrawing properties due to the trifluoromethyl groups, enhancing the compound's potential for biological activity and interaction with various targets. This compound may exhibit interesting properties such as fluorescence or photochemical behavior, making it of interest in fields like materials science and medicinal chemistry. Its unique structure suggests potential applications in drug development or as a building block in organic synthesis. However, specific physical properties such as solubility, melting point, and stability would require empirical measurement or detailed literature references for comprehensive understanding.
Formula:C19H11F6NO2
